Cyclicities refer to patterns or trends that repeat in a predictable manner over time. These cycles can occur in various aspects of life, such as economics, nature, and human behavior.

Types of Cyclicities

There are several types of cyclicities that have been identified by researchers, including economic cycles, climate cycles, and biological cycles. Economic cycles, for example, involve periods of growth and recession that repeat over time. Climate cycles, such as El Niño and La Niña, have a significant impact on weather patterns around the world. Biological cycles, like the menstrual cycle in humans, follow a regular pattern of events.
